Understanding the Essence of Juicing

Juicing is the process of extracting the liquid from fruits, vegetables, and leafy greens, resulting in a concentrated source of vitamins, minerals, enzymes, and antioxidants. By consuming these nutrient-dense juices, individuals can augment their overall well-being, bolster their immune system, and promote a healthier lifestyle.

Preparing Your Ingredients: A Symphony of Freshness

The foundation of a great juice lies in the quality of its ingredients. Select fresh, ripe fruits and vegetables, ensuring they are thoroughly washed and cut into manageable pieces. For leafy greens, remove any tough stems or wilted leaves.

Assembling Your Omega Juicer: A Step-by-Step Guide

1. Secure the Base: Place the juicer base on a stable surface and ensure it is securely plugged into an outlet.

2. Attach the Feed Chute: Align the feed chute with the base and twist it clockwise until it locks into place.

3. Insert the Auger: Carefully insert the auger into the feed chute, ensuring it is properly aligned.

4. Attach the Strainer: Choose the desired strainer (fine or coarse) and place it inside the juicer housing.

5. Secure the Pulp Container: Align the pulp container with the juicer housing and twist it clockwise until it locks into place.

6. Attach the Juice Container: Place the juice container beneath the juicer spout and ensure it is securely attached.

Juicing with Your Omega Juicer: A Culinary Symphony

1. Power On: Turn on the juicer and allow it to reach its operating speed.

2. Feed the Ingredients: Gradually feed the prepared ingredients into the feed chute, using the pusher to gently guide them down.

3. Extract the Juice: The juicer will separate the juice from the pulp, depositing the juice into the juice container and the pulp into the pulp container.

4. Enjoy the Freshness: Once all the ingredients have been juiced, turn off the juicer and savor the delicious, nutrient-rich juice.

Cleaning and Maintenance: Preserving Optimal Performance

1. Disassemble the Juicer: After each use, disassemble the juicer and rinse the components thoroughly under running water.

2. Deep Clean: Periodically, deep clean the juicer by soaking the removable parts in a solution of warm water and dish soap.

3. Dry Thoroughly: Ensure all components are completely dry before reassembling the juicer.

Storing Fresh Juices: Capturing Nature’s Goodness

1. Refrigeration: Freshly squeezed juices can be stored in airtight containers in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.

2. Freezing: For longer storage, consider freezing the juices in airtight containers or ice cube trays. Frozen juices can be stored for up to 6 months.

Questions We Hear a Lot

Q: Can I juice citrus fruits with my Omega Juicer?

A: Yes, you can juice citrus fruits with an Omega Juicer. However, it’s recommended to peel the citrus fruits before juicing to avoid any bitterness from the rind.

Q: How often should I clean my Omega Juicer?

A: It’s recommended to clean your Omega Juicer after each use to maintain optimal performance and prevent the buildup of bacteria.

Q: Can I juice leafy greens with my Omega Juicer?

A: Yes, you can juice leafy greens with an Omega Juicer. However, it’s recommended to roll up the leafy greens and feed them slowly into the juicer to prevent jamming.
